Fenwick backs $3.5M seed round for litigation AI startup Advocacy

Why this matters
Fenwick & West is putting capital behind AI. A meaningful marker of where the firm's capability is heading.
Fenwick & West participated as an investor in a $3.5 million seed funding round for Advocacy, a litigation tech startup, led by venture firm Relentless with participation from Rel Labs (Relativity's investment arm), T14 law school investors, and Big Law/litigation boutique partners. At least the second legal tech startup Fenwick has backed, following SingleFile in 2025.
